What is the difference?ĭownload speed is how fast you can retrieve data from the internet, whereas upload speed is the speed you can send data from your devices to the internet. What download speeds do I need? Download vs Upload speed. Although bandwidth is often used to refer to your internet speeds, there is a slight difference, internet speeds are the rate of data transfer, while your bandwidth is how much your connection can handle at a given time. Internet bandwidth is the maximum amount of data that can be transferred across your connection at a given time. A megabyte is actually 8 megabits, so to download a 1MB file on a 1Mbps connection would take 8 seconds. How is broadband speed measured?īroadband speed is measured in bits, with most broadband packages measured in megabits-per-second (Mbps).Īn important distinction to make is megabits(Mb) vs megabytes(MB).įiles are normally described in megabytes.

What is a good broadband speed for streaming Video?ģMbps is the minimum broadband speed required to stream on most platforms in standard definition (SD), 5Mbps is the minimum to stream in HD, while 25Mbps is the minimum download speed required for Ultra HD. What can I do with my internet speed?ġ0Mbps – One person: surfing the web, social media, online shopping, SD streamingĤ0Mbps – HD streaming, online gaming, multiple people: surfing the web, social media, online shoppingġ00Mbps – Ultra HD streaming, HD streaming for multiple people, online gaming for multiple peopleĢ50Mbps – Multiple heavy users, ultrafast downloads, Ultra HD on multiple devicesĩ00Mbps – Simultaneous UHD streaming, online gaming and large downloads for almost any number of devices
For example, you’ll want to use your HD TV to stream Netflix in HD, which requires at least 5Mbps (Ultra HD requires 25Mbps).Īt the same time, someone else in the house may be online gaming, or watching a YouTube video, while another person is on a video call with their friends.Īll these activities chip away at your bandwidth, and having only 10Mbps between you won’t get you very far – that’s why our packages start at a minimum of 40Mbps.
